Scott Walker hires another unqualified campaign worker
http://www.jsonline.com/news/statepolitics/120331509.html

<snip>

In picking a new register of deeds for Marinette County, Gov. Scott Walker picked a Republican campaign worker with no experience with land records and vital records.

He passed over three candidates with detailed knowledge of how the office of the register of deeds works, including two deputies who have worked in the office for years.

The appointment comes after the GOP governor faced criticism because the son of a campaign supporter landed a top job at the state Department of Commerce.

Renee Miller started as Marinette County register of deeds on Wednesday, after being appointed to it earlier this month. Miller is a friend of Rep. John Nygren (R-Marinette), has worked on his campaigns for five years and is married to Nygren's campaign treasurer, Paul Miller.
